Base System Installation Checklist: [O] = OK, [E] = Error (please elaborate below), [ ] = didn't try it Initial boot: [O] Detect network card: [O] Configure network: [O] Detect CD: [O] Load installer modules: [O] Detect hard drives: [O] Partition hard drives: [O] Install base system: [O] Clock/timezone setup: [O] User/password setup: [O] Install tasks: [O] Install boot loader: [E] Overall install: [ ] Comments/Problems: <Description of the install, in prose, and any thoughts, comments and ideas you had during the initial install.>

Using VirtualBox 5.1.6 on a Windows 7 host, I created a virtual machine with the described above specifications, and inserted the Debian Stretch RC1 netinst .iso file as a CD.
I tried both the graphical and the text mode installer - the result was same in both.

I selected the default en_us options except for Finnish keyboard layout and Finland as the physical location. In the disk partitioning part I selected the guided LVM option, and from there, all the default options.
For the installable software I only selected the SSH server and the base system tools (and unselected the desktop environment).
For the GRUB installation I selected the /sda option from the two available options: Manual and /sda
The installation hangs at 66% "Installing GRUB boot loader" with the text Running "update-grub"...
